Getting There

  • Bus

    To reach The Bigger Potato from Canberra city center, begin your journey at the Canberra Central Bus Station. Take the 'Murrumbateman' or 'Bungendore' bus route. Ensure to check the latest bus schedule as service times may vary. Once on the bus, enjoy the scenic views of the Australian countryside. After approximately 30 minutes, disembark at the Bungendore stop. From there, you will need to walk approximately 1.5 kilometers along the North Black Range Firetrail. Follow the signs towards The Bigger Potato, which will be on your right.

  • Taxi or Rideshare

    If you prefer a more direct route, you can use a taxi or rideshare service like Uber from anywhere in Canberra. Simply input 'The Bigger Potato, N Black Range Firetrail, Bungendore NSW 2621' as your destination. The journey will take about 30-40 minutes depending on traffic. Make sure to confirm with your driver that they are aware of the specific location, as it is a popular tourist attraction.

  • Bicycle

    For the more adventurous tourists, renting a bicycle can be an enjoyable way to reach The Bigger Potato. Start from the Canberra city center and head towards Bungendore via the bike-friendly paths. The distance is approximately 30 kilometers, so ensure you are prepared for the ride. Follow the signs to Bungendore, and once you arrive in the town, navigate towards North Black Range Firetrail. The Bigger Potato will be along this trail. Remember to wear a helmet and stay hydrated!

Discover more about The Bigger Potato

Nestled in the picturesque region of Bungendore, New South Wales, The Bigger Potato is more than just a quirky roadside attraction; it’s a celebration of the agricultural heritage of Australia. Towering above its surroundings, this oversized potato sculpture stands as a testament to the local farming community and the importance of potatoes in the area. Visitors flock to this whimsical site to capture fun photographs and enjoy a light-hearted moment in a rural setting. Surrounded by beautiful countryside, The Bigger Potato offers not just a photo opportunity but also a chance to appreciate the serene landscapes that define this part of New South Wales. As you approach The Bigger Potato, you’ll be greeted by its impressive size and distinctive design, which make it an ideal spot for families and friends looking to create lasting memories. The attraction is conveniently located along the N Black Range Firetrail, making it easily accessible for those traveling through the region. While there, take a moment to explore the surrounding area, where you can find charming local shops and eateries that showcase the flavors of the region. The Bigger Potato is not only a tourist attraction but also a delightful reminder of the community spirit and creativity that permeates Bungendore. Whether you're a traveler seeking unique experiences or a local wanting to show off a piece of your heritage, The Bigger Potato is a delightful stop worth making on your journey.
